Hanapepe (Guide)

Hanapepe on Kauai provides reliable fishing for papio ulua and bonefish from the river mouth or small boats with outgoing tides concentrating fish in the estuary and nearshore reefs. Local ramps in the area support kayaks and small craft for bay and coastal runs. Beaches at Salt Pond Beach Park and nearby Hanapepe Bay offer protected sand for family outings picnics and relaxation with views of the scenic west side. The charming town atmosphere adds to the enjoyment of tide aware fishing days.

Salt Pond Beach Park (Tide Pool)

Salt Pond Beach Park near Hanapepe on Kauai provides family-friendly, protected tide pools along its rocky edges, filled with small tropical fish, crabs, hermit crabs, and other gentle marine life in shallow, calm waters. With lifeguards, amenities, and a crescent golden beach, it's one of the safest and most accessible spots for kids to explore Hawaii's intertidal zones. Perfect year-round - combine with picnicking for a relaxing day.

Port Allen Small Boat Harbor (Other)

State managed small boat harbor on the eastern shore of Hanapepe Bay featuring a two lane thirty foot wide launch ramp thirty four berths six moorings loading dock fish hoist pump out station and restrooms for recreational boating fishing charters and access to Na Pali Coast tours. Convenient for trailered boats kayaks and small craft launches with protected waters in the bay where tidal ranges influence harbor levels navigation and nearshore conditions enhancing opportunities for coastal trips and observing marine life. Key facility on Kauai south shore with proximity to restaurants galleries and charters making it ideal for combining harbor use with tide aware outings and exploring west side waters.

Salt Pond Beach Park (Other)

County beach park in Hanapepe featuring protected shallow pools sandy shoreline pavilions picnic tables restrooms showers lifeguard and camping areas for family swimming snorkeling picnics and relaxation on Kauai west side. Excellent for low tide exploration of tide pools discovering marine life in clear waters behind natural fringing reefs and enjoying calm conditions influenced by tidal cycles that expose more pools or change water depth for safe shore activities. Popular spot with scenic views combining beach time shore fishing sunset watching and proximity to nearby Port Allen harbor for a full coastal experience.
